HC Deb 10 December 1942 vol 385 c1726W
Sir Smedley Crooke

asked the Secretary of State for Air whether he is aware of the growing feeling of disappointment felt by the boys in the Birmingham area of the Air Training Corps at the non-issue of overcoats; and will he consider the advisability of issuing overcoats in some other colour if the cause of the non-issue is the scarcity of blue cloth?

Sir A. Sinclair

It is well understood in the Air Training Corps that the issue of overcoats is precluded by the shortage of material, and I am informed by my right hon. Friend the Minister of Production that he is not hopeful that the difficulty can be overcome. The shortage is not restricted to blue cloth.
